Description

A kind of recycling processing method cleaning train sewage
Technical field
The invention belongs to technical field of sewage, recycle processing side more particularly to a kind of cleaning train sewage Method.
Background technique
With the rapid development of metro industry, the cleaning of the track trains such as subway is increasingly frequent, in the theory of energy-saving and emission-reduction Under, the recycling of car washing water becomes a big emphasis of industry development, and with being becoming tight the day of water resource, sewage treatment is net Change to recycle and has become an important development direction indispensable in socio-economic development, and conventional sewage processing stream at present Journey lacks targetedly effective scheme to the circular treatment of train water for cleaning.
Summary of the invention
The technical issues of in order to solve in the presence of the prior art, the present invention provides a kind of circulations for cleaning train sewage Utilize processing method.Train cleaning prewet, spray early period using recycle-water, brushes and smear, scrub and first flushing work, uses clear water Carry out fine to wash and essence scrub, carry out whole flushing with softened water, softened water utilizes clear water water source, by soften water treatment facilities into Row preparation, is stored in dedicated softening pond after the completion of preparation, and demineralized water treatment device utilizes the calcium ions and magnesium ions in resin adsorption clear water Realize the softening to water source;To solve the problems, such as water process and recycling after train cleaning, the technical solution that the present invention takes Are as follows:
A kind of recycling processing method cleaning train sewage, comprising the following steps:
A. the water after cleaning train collects by collecting gutter, and collecting gutter is arranged in washing track, and the water during carwash is received Collect and be guided to collecting-tank, by entering collecting-tank after the coarse filtration of grid;
B. blender and PH detection device are provided in collecting-tank, blender carries out return water uniformly mixed in collecting-tank, Return water controls soda acid dosing metering pump pair by water process PLC after mixing according to the monitoring of the PH detection device in collecting-tank Return water carries out acid-base neutralization processing in collecting-tank, in the reasonable scope by the pH value control of return water;In collecting-tank while stirring The addition for carrying out flocculant and flocculation aid plays the role of flocculation sedimentation to promote subsequent contamination precipitation in sedimentation basin after mixing, Reduce the pollutant loads such as BOD and COD and suspended matter in water;A preparation and a use immersible pump is equipped in collecting-tank, in collecting-tank Immersible pump is equipped with floating ball lever meter and carries out dynamic regulation, and two position is arranged, is stirred according to the water in collecting-tank, dosing With discharge operation;
C. uniformly mixed return water is squeezed into sedimentation basin by the immersible pump in collecting-tank, return water passes through top in sedimentation basin Portion's overcurrent mouth, by sedimentation basin three partitions, the successively precipitating separated by sedimentation basin three realizes impurity in return water for gravity flow Purification;
D. the water after precipitating, from oil separator is flowed into, is equipped with Oil scraper in oil separator, is removed by Oil scraper by the mouth of a river Most grease in water;
E. photocatalysis pond is flowed into after scraping oil processing, photocatalysis pond is the intermediate mistake before mechanical filter and photocatalysis treatment Filter tank sets a preparation and a use immersible pump in photocatalysis pond, the return water stage after frizing is supplied in mechanical filter;
F. mechanical filter includes two filtering tanks of quartz sand filtration tank and active carbon filtration tank, and two filtering tanks are using string The mode of connection connects, and quartz sand filtration tank is used to remove the impurity such as the suspended matter in water, and active carbon filtration tank is for removing in water Peculiar smell, the operation of mechanical filter tank is automatic running, has automatic back-flushing function;
G. filtered water enters photocatalysis equipment and is catalyzed, and photocatalysis equipment is using photon irradiation, and removal is killed Escherichia coli, staphylococcus aureus, Friedlander's bacillus, Pseudomonas aeruginosa, virus etc., while also there is deodorization, mould proof anti- The effect of algae, anti-fouling and self-cleaning;
H. the water after being catalyzed returns to back pool and is stored, and when carwash is sent water to required station using water pump.
Preferably, the control that the using and the reserved immersible pump in collecting-tank and photocatalysis pond passes through water process PLC carries out week Phase property ground alternately operating guarantees that immersible pump is permanently effective, improves the service life of immersible pump.
Preferably, flocculant is polyacrylamide.
Preferably, flocculation aid is aluminium polychloride.
The utility model has the advantages that present system automatic running, excessively intervenes without operator, has saved human cost, it is high-efficient, Treated, and water can reach " TB/T 3007-2000 railway quality of reused water standard " requirement, clean experience in conjunction with track train, Reasonability, validity and the specific aim of General Promotion train water for cleaning circular treatment, reduce the consumption of water resource.
